Why Do You Get Red Eyes After Smoking Weed?
One of the clearest signs that you have smoked cannabis sativa is red eyes. That’s especially for new users and others who are prone to bloodshot eyes. Not to say that there is anything wrong with having red eyes after smoking a joint of weed. Bloodshot eyes occur as a side effect of smoking weed and are not dangerous. It is completely normal.

7 Medicinal & Therapeutic Uses of CBD Oil
To start with a basic understanding, CBD oil is a component to be found in Industrial Hemp, which is one of the varieties of cannabis sativa plant. Now, both CBD and marijuana are derived from the same genus, but the former contains a lower amount of Tetrahydrocannabinol (THC), 0.3 percent or less, and the later contains a concentration of 15 percent to 40 percent. THC is a component which makes you feel high due to its psychoactive properties. The question arises here that how can CBD oil benefit human health in any manner? Its history is dated a long time back when ancient healers made use of its medicinal benefits to treat patients. In the current scenario, clinical and lab-tested researches have proved CBD oil to benefit treating certain symptoms with the right dosage. Is Vaping Cannabis a Safer Alternative to Smoking?
Cannabis is one of the few drugs that have been used for treatment since ancient times. While the modern use of it for medicinal purposes has been one of the most controversial topics in the medical field, more and more countries are now approving its use. However, regardless of the legal status of the drug in your country, one of the questions that still remain unanswered is whether smoking cannabis is harmful to the lungs. While smoking has been the most common way of taking marijuana for the longest time, this method of consuming cannabis carries with it a number of health risks. By now, we all know that smoking tobacco is bad for one’s health.
